Scottish Junior Sous Chef Recognised with a Rising Star Award

On Monday 23 February, at an awards presentation held at CORD by Le Cordon Bleu on Fleet Street, London, Fin MacDonald, Junior Sous Chef at The Dipping Lugger in Ullapool, Ross-shire, was presented with a Rising Star Award by the National Restaurant Awards.

On receiving his award, Fin said: “I didn’t think for one minute that I’d be presented with an award, let alone a Rising Star Award from the National Restaurant Awards. I’m a little lost for words, if I’m being perfectly honest. But I’d really like to thank Robert Hicks and Helen Chalmers, the owners of The Dipping Lugger, and my head chef, David Smith, for supporting me and helping me grow as a chef.

Seed Swap starts!

“The Germinator “ is back. Yes, Ullapool Seed Swap is on again at Ullapool Library from Monday  2nd – Friday 13 March.

This year the Swap has a new leader, Noelle Pierce, with Rosie taking a step back from all the organising.

A new novel by Moray writer Euan Martin, Alves-based Moray playwright, Euan Martin, has released his first novel. Entitled Funeral Party, it is described as a “dark comedy”, and the story follows the fortunes of a group of old friends who have formed a secret society with the aim of helping each other achieve a satisfactory death. (On sale in the Ceilidh Place bookshop – moved spaces to the old Parlour within the C Place.)
Euan was a regular visitor to Ullapool with performances in the Macphail Theatre with The Right Lines company.
